The Rise of Novel Psychoactive Substances: A Growing Concern
The emergence of novel psychoactive substances (NPS), often referred to as “designer drugs,” represents a significant major public health medical challenge globally. These are frequently synthesized created to mimic the effects of illicit controlled drugs while circumventing existing laws rules. Research Chemicals: What Are They and How Do They Work?
Research substances represent a increasingly broad collection of synthetic compounds that are generally produced and distributed for research purposes. They are usually designed to replicate the effects of established psychoactive medications but often possess notably different chemical compositions . Due to they are intended primarily for experimental analysis, they frequently lack extensive safety information . Their mechanism of action can involve interacting with brain chemicals like dopamine , endorphins , or serotonin , affecting cognitive function and creating varied emotional effects.
